Delhi Besichtigung

After breakfast, embark on a full-day sightseeing tour of Delhi:

  • Jama Masjid – The largest mosque in India, built by Emperor Shah Jahan in 1656, with its magnificent domes and expansive courtyard.
  • Chandni Chowk – A vibrant, bustling bazaar in Old Delhi, perfect for exploring narrow lanes filled with colourful shops offering spices, textiles, jewellery, and street food delights.
  • Fatehpuri Masjid – A historic mosque at the edge of Chandni Chowk, offering a peaceful retreat amidst the city’s bustle.
  • Enjoy a rickshaw ride through Chandni Chowk to the iconic Red Fort a 17th-century UNESCO World Heritage site.
  • Raj Ghat – A tranquil memorial where Mahatma Gandhi was cremated, with an eternal flame symbolising his enduring legacy.
  • Humayun’s Tomb – A masterpiece of Mughal architecture and the first garden-style tomb in India, surrounded by four lush gardens and waterways.
  • Drive past Rashtrapati Bhawan, the residence of the President of India, and India Gate, a war memorial honouring soldiers who died in World War I.
  • Qutub Minar – The tallest brick minaret in the world, built in 1193 by Qutb-ud-din Aibak, marking the dawn of Muslim rule in India.

Return to your hotel for overnight stay in Delhi.


Tag 3

DELHI - AGRA (205 KM/CA. 4-5 STD.)

After breakfast, depart for Agra.

Agra, located on the banks of the Yamuna River, flourished as the capital of the Mughal Empire between 1526 and 1628. Today, it stands as a treasure trove of architectural brilliance, home to three UNESCO World Heritage sites: the Taj Mahal, Agra Fort, and Fatehpur Sikri.

On arrival, check in at the hotel and relax before beginning your sightseeing tour:

Agra Fort – A red sandstone marvel built in the 16th century, with royal chambers, audience halls, mosques, and intricate mirror work. Highlights include the Diwan-i-Aam (Hall of Public Audience), Diwan-i-Khas (Hall of Private Audience), and Sheesh Mahal (Palace of Mirrors).



Taj Mahal – The epitome of eternal love, built by Emperor Shah Jahan in memory of his wife Mumtaz Mahal. This ivory-white marble mausoleum changes hue through the day — pink at dawn, milky white by day, and golden under moonlight. Watching the sunset here is a truly unforgettable experience.



Overnight stay at hotel in Agra.


Tag 4

AGRA - JAIPUR (260 KM/CA. 5-6 STD.) ÜBER FATEHPUR SIKRI

Post breakfast, check out and drive to Jaipur — the magnificent Pink City of India.

En route, visit:

Fatehpur Sikri – A UNESCO World Heritage site, this abandoned Mughal capital built in the late 16th century by Emperor Akbar is a testament to architectural grandeur. Highlights include the Buland Darwaza (the highest gateway in the world), Panch Mahal (a five-storey pavilion), and Dargah of Sheikh Salim Chisti (a revered shrine known for its marble carvings).


Continue the drive to Jaipur, arriving in the city known for its majestic forts, vibrant bazaars, and rich Rajput heritage. Upon arrival, check in at your hotel.

Overnight stay at hotel in Jaipur.


Tag 5

Jaipur Sehenswürdigkeiten

After breakfast, set out for an exciting day exploring Jaipur:

Amber Fort – Dating back to the 16th century, this fort is a blend of Hindu and Mughal architecture, with exquisite halls, courtyards, and temples. Enjoy a scenic Jeep ride to the fort entrance, and admire its reflection in Maota Lake.


City Palace – A splendid palace complex showcasing a fusion of Rajput and Mughal styles, with museums, courtyards, and royal collections of art and armour.


Jantar Mantar – An astronomical observatory built in the 18th century by Maharaja Sawai Jai Singh II, featuring the world’s largest sundial (Samrat Yantra).


Photo stop at Hawa Mahal – Known as the Palace of Winds, this five-storey façade with 953 intricately carved windows offered royal women a way to observe street life unseen.


The afternoon is free for shopping at Jaipur’s bustling bazaars, famous for textiles, handicrafts, jewellery, carpets, and souvenirs.

Overnight stay at hotel in Jaipur.

Tag 7

JODHPUR - UDAIPUR - UNTERWEGS RANAKPUR JAIN-TEMPEL (260 KM/CA. 6 STD.)

After an early breakfast, begin your Jodhpur sightseeing:

Mehrangarh Fort – One of India’s largest forts, perched on a perpendicular cliff 400 feet above the city. Admire its imposing gates, intricate carvings, expansive courtyards, palaces, temples, and galleries showcasing royal artefacts and armour. From the fort’s ramparts, enjoy breathtaking panoramic views of the city below.


Jaswant Thada – A beautiful white marble cenotaph built in memory of Maharaja Jaswant Singh II, known for its delicate carvings and serene gardens.



Continue your journey to Udaipur with an enchanting stop:

Ranakpur Jain Temple – A stunning 15th-century marble temple dedicated to Lord Adinath, featuring over 1,400 intricately carved pillars, none alike. Recognised as a marvel of Jain architecture, it is among the most exquisite religious monuments in India.


Arrive in Udaipur, the “City of Lakes” and a jewel of Rajasthan. Known for its romantic charm, palaces, and scenic lakes, Udaipur reflects the grandeur of Rajput royalty. Check in at your hotel and relax.

Overnight stay at hotel in Udaipur.


Tag 8

UDAIPUR BESICHTIGUNG

After breakfast, enjoy a full day exploring the picturesque city of Udaipur:

City Palace – A sprawling palace complex on the banks of Lake Pichola, blending Rajasthani and Mughal architecture. Explore courtyards, balconies, museums, and the zenana (women’s quarters), all offering magnificent views of the lake and the city.


Jagdish Temple – An impressive Indo-Aryan temple dedicated to Lord Vishnu, with beautifully carved pillars and intricate sculptures.


Saheliyon Ki Bari – “Garden of the Maidens,” adorned with fountains, lotus pools, marble pavilions, and lush greenery.


Bharatiya Lok Kala Mandal – A cultural centre preserving Rajasthani traditions, including folk art, costumes, puppetry, and musical instruments.


Lake Pichola Boat Ride – A serene boat ride to view the City Palace, Lake Palace, and Jag Mandir Island, offering unforgettable sunset vistas.


Overnight stay at hotel in Udaipur.

Tag 10

MUMBAI-BESICHTIGUNG

After breakfast, embark on a full-day sightseeing tour of Mumbai:

Elephanta Caves – Located on Elephanta Island, accessible by a ferry ride from the Gateway of India. Dating between the 5th–8th centuries, these rock-cut caves house intricate sculptures, including the impressive 20 ft high Trimurti (three-faced) statue of Lord Shiva.


Gateway of India – Mumbai’s iconic landmark built in 1924 to commemorate King George V and Queen Mary’s visit.


Prince of Wales Museum (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Vastu Sangrahalaya) – Showcasing art, sculpture, and artefacts, blending Indo-Saracenic architecture with Mughal design.


Hanging Gardens – Nestled atop Malabar Hill, offering lush gardens, a floral clock, and panoramic views of the Arabian Sea.


Marine Drive – Known as the “Queen’s Necklace,” this 3.6 km-long boulevard along the coastline glistens at night, offering a perfect end to your sightseeing.


Return to your hotel for overnight stay.
